Abstract

The utility model relates to a face lighting source device able to dual-side give off which comprises a light conducting plate, an optical membrane with functions of light reflection and light transmission, a diffusion slice, a prismatic lens and a lamp source. The lamp source is disposed at the end edging of the light conducting plate; one side surface of the light conducting plate is provided with the diffusion and the prismatic lens in turn; the other side of the light conducting plate is provided with the optical membrane, the diffusion slice and the prismatic lens in turn. The utility model can make the light transmitted from the lamp source be reflected by the optical membrane and go out towards one side of the light conducting plate to form a first light-out side for a part of the light and penetrate the optical membrane and go out towards the reverse direction of the light-out side to form a second light-out side for the rest part, when the light transmitted from the lamp source passes the optical membrane after passing the light conducting plate.

[technical field]
The utility model is about a kind of planar light source device that can two-sided bright dipping, can provide the commodity that need double-sided display function to use.
[background technology]
As shown in Figure 1, 2, the planar light source device that general display is mated, differentiation has front light-source device 1, reach 2 two kinds of backlight arrangements: summary, the composition of front light-source device 1, be to establish a LGP 12,, can reach the function of demonstration by light source bright dipping after reflected displaying device 11 reflections of lamp source 13 outputs that are arranged at LGP 12 sides by the place ahead of a reflected displaying device 11.And the composition of backlight arrangement 2, be to establish a LGP 22 by the back side of a display 21, establish a reflecting plate 23 again in the bottom surface of LGP 22, and be provided with lamp source 24 to supply with light source in the side of LGP 22, in the application, they be to make the light source of lamp source 24 outputs, and reflecting plate 23 reflection backs are towards display 21 inputs, in order to the usefulness of bright dipping demonstration through LGP 22 refractions.More than two kinds of planar light source devices, use for a long time for the display industry haply, especially the application of backlight arrangement 2 is extensive especially.
No matter and display applied be front light-source device 1, or backlight arrangement 2 its applicable exiting surfaces have only single exiting surface, the relevant dealer who often makes or use display limits to some extent.For instance, in the mobile phone of a new generation, towards transmitting image, in order to transmit image, the mobile phone dealer promptly as shown in Figure 3 on the function; Establish a key frame viewing area 31 in the cover inboard of mobile phone 3, when this key frame viewing area 31 is flat except showing general message, more can demonstrate the portrait or the landscape image that receive, wherein taking in image then is the phtographic lens 32 that utilizes in the mobile phone 3, the image that captures is gone out by the electronic equipment of phone itself, after making the recipient receive, show for watching in key frame display 31; Yet, if the user is generally more easy to operate when the oneself takes, because of mobile phone 3 being gripped with hand, phtographic lens 32 is aimed at towards oneself, whether and to utilize key frame viewing area 31 to see and look be best picture, and comply with the required mobile phone 3 that adjusts slightly again and can take, if but when taking his thing, because of most of phtographic lenses 32 suffer the foreign matter wearing and tearing or hide for avoiding, so phtographic lens 32 is arranged at the phone medial surface, at this moment, then his object space of phtographic lens 32 reversed alignment can must be taken, and in order to obtain best shooting picture, existing dealer is in addition in the back side of key frame viewing area 31, it is the cover lateral surface of mobile phone 3, one form viewing area 33 is set, the person of being convenient to operation is from form viewing area 33, whether sight is looked the image frame of desire shooting and is satisfied with, and the foundation that is further adjusted, in addition, the part dealer is also arranged, application with this form viewing area 33 has added incoming call display function, promptly when incoming call is arranged, can learn the telephone number of first speaker by 33 horse backs from the form viewing area, and needn't raise phone.Based on so, mobile phone 3 promptly must configuration two group display equipments, more for this two group display equipment; Then must two groups of planar light source devices of configuration, thus, not only on foot increase cost, make mobile phone 3 weight strengthen again, volume strengthens, even disappearance such as power supply consumption increasing, so the solution of a problem is very urgent, its improved necessity is arranged.
[utility model content]
The purpose of this utility model is to be to provide a kind of planar light source device that can two-sided bright dipping, and it can reach the usefulness of two-sided bright dipping, uses for the commodity that need double-sided display function.
In order to achieve the above object, the utility model provides a kind of planar light source device that can two-sided bright dipping, comprising: blooming piece and diffusion sheet, prismatic lens and the lamp source of a LGP, tool light reflection and light transmission function is characterized in that:
The lamp source is arranged at this LGP end limit, and a side of this LGP disposes this diffusion sheet and this prismatic lens in regular turn, and the another side of this LGP then disposes this blooming piece, this diffusion sheet and this prismatic lens in regular turn.
In sum, the utility model can two-sided bright dipping planar light source device, it is the blooming piece that tool reflection and transmission dual-use function are set in a side of LGP, the light source that makes illuminator output is through LGP during again through blooming piece, part light source can be after blooming piece reflection towards a side bright dipping of LGP, and form first exiting surface; Another part light source then after the blooming piece transmission, towards the opposite direction bright dipping of first exiting surface, and forms second exiting surface, to reach the usefulness of two-sided bright dipping, can offer the commodity that need double-sided display function and use.

[specific embodiment]
For making further understanding structure of the present utility model, reach the function that can reach, explanation of conjunction with figs. and preferred embodiment now as back:
At first, as shown in Figure 4, be the planar light source device 4 of a kind of two-sided bright dipping of the present utility model, include a LGP 41, and dispose one or several lamp sources 42 in LGP 41 end limits, and, be provided with light diffusing sheet 43 and one or more prismatic lens 44 in a side of LGP 41; Forming first exiting surface 45, the another side of LGP 41, then the blooming piece 46 of reflection of configuration one tool and transmission dual-use function earlier is provided with light diffusing sheet 47 more in regular turn, and one or more prismatic lens 48; To form second exiting surface 49, as shown in Figure 5, after receiving the light source that comes from lamp source 42 when LGP 41, the light source of a part can be through LGP 41 internal reflections, and be subjected to blooming piece 46 to possess the two factor of part light reflection function, the light source of a part is done the diffusion of light towards light diffusing sheet 43, and after prismatic lens 44 gives effective optically focused, and can be at first exiting surface, 45 smooth output light sources, with desire utilize this light source configuration display application it; Again, the light source that comes from lamp source 42 equally, except that aforementioned towards the output of first exiting surface 45, another part light source then through LGP 41 through blooming piece 46 time, then because of blooming piece 46 has the light transmissive function of part, and make the light source of its transmission can be again to do the diffusion of light through light diffusing sheet 47 even, give effective optically focused through prismatic lens 48 again, and carry out output light source in second exiting surface, make another display of desire configuration use.
As shown in Figure 6, if when implementing as use of the present utility model with the mobile phone commodity, wherein the key frame viewing area 31 of mobile phone 3 is because main viewing area, form viewing area 33 then is a secondary display area, so can be according to the actual required collocation of first exiting surface 45 and second exiting surface 49 being done the Different Light output quantity, promptly cooperating the two ratio of the reflectivity of blooming piece 46 and transmissivity to do different the adjustment uses, and in existing the reflectivity of these blooming pieces 46 mostly a little more than transmissivity, so, in other words, because of using the light reflection performance, and can obtain used than first exiting surface 45 of the multiple light courcess picture-display-region 31 of can deciding, and utilize second exiting surface 49 of light transmission usefulness, because of its light source a little less than first exiting surface 45, then selecting for use becomes form viewing area 33, and the two can reach the collocation on the practice, and makes unlikely waste of light source and not enough situation take place.
